Guatemala Youth Delegation (Extended Deadline)



Guatemala: Human Rights Delegation for Young Leaders
July 31 - August 20, 2005

EXTENDED DEADLINE - Now accepting applications until APRIL 1, 2005.


Global Youth Connect is pleased to announce that we are currently
recruiting young leaders to participate in a human rights delegation to
Guatemala from July 31 - August 20, 2005.

This experiential education program will take participants to Guatemala
City, Antigua, and Quiche (one of the areas of Guatemala most affected by
the armed conflict) to explore the range of human rights issues that are
currently impacting Guatemala's development.

Participants will meet with leading human rights defenders, government
representatives, youth and others from local communities to learn about
the political and social challenges faced by Guatemalans.  We will connect
with young Guatemalans in an interactive workshop designed to build
cross-cultural understanding.  Through hands-on service activities,
participants will also have a chance to work side-by-side with Guatemalans
in finding positive solutions to social and economic concerns.

We invite interested young leaders to apply.  We are looking for
participants who are between the ages of 18-25, possess U.S. citizenship
or residency, or are studying full-time at a U.S. college or university.
Most importantly, applicants should wish to expand their knowledge and
understanding of human rights and social justice.  Spanish proficiency is
required.  The deadline to receive applications is April 1, 2005.
